#4f0591 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#4f0591 is composed of 31% red, 2% green and 56.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 45.5% cyan, 96.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 43.1% black. It has a hue angle of 271.7 degrees, a saturation of 93.3% and a lightness of 29.4%. #4f0591 color hex could be obtained by blending #9e0aff with #000023. Closest websafe color is: #660099.

Shades and Tints of #4f0591

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#07000c is the darkest color, while #fcf8ff is the lightest one.

Tones of #4f0591

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4b4a4c is the less saturated color, while #4f0591 is the most saturated one.
